Jharkhand Student Protest: Police Fire Tear Gas, Use Water Cannons On Job Aspirants Near Assembly

Tensions escalated near the Jharkhand Vidhan Sabha as police used water cannons, tear gas and baton charges against job aspirants protesting alleged irregularities in recruitment examinations. The protesters breached barricades and moved towards the Assembly premises, following several rounds of talks with the state government that failed to resolve the deadlock. The agitators said the government had agreed to cancel only three of the 13 exams they want scrapped.
